Direct Cost Comparison: Upfront, Ongoing, and Insurance Factors

If you want to save money, start by looking at the upfront price and who pays for it. You pay about $65–$70 monthly for VigRX Plus with no help from insurance. That hits monthly affordability hard. Rx pills can cost $30–$60 a pill but insurance may cut costs. What'll you choose?

Next, think about ongoing costs. VigRX Plus is daily, so bills repeat. Rx drugs can be as-needed, so you may spend less if you use them rarely. But you might pay for doctor visits first.

In the end, check insurance barriers and your use pattern before deciding. Consider timing purchases around seasonal sales to maximize savings.

Convenience and Dosing: Daily Supplements vs. On-Demand Pills

You just compared money and access, so now let’s look at how you’ll actually use each option.

You take VigRX Plus every day. One pill in the morning and one at night. That needs daily adherence. It builds slowly. You may feel better in weeks. You must buy monthly boxes.

Or you keep a few rx tablets for quick use. Take one 30–60 minutes before sex. That gives fast help. Pocket portability makes it easy to carry.

Which fits you? Do you want a routine or on-demand ease? Think about habits, privacy, and how often you plan intimacy. You can also track typical timelines for improvement with VigRX Plus to set realistic expectations.
